Bipartisan US heavyweights back climate risk study

2014-06-19 16:00:00| Climate Ark Climate Change & Global Warming Newsfeed

Financial Times: A study of the financial risks to the US from global warming, backed by former Treasury secretaries Hank Paulson, Robert Rubin and George Shultz, will be published next week in an effort to change the way American businesses and politicians think about climate change. The Risky Business project is chaired by Mr Paulson, Tom Steyer, a billionaire environmentalist, and Michael Bloomberg, former mayor of New York.
